org.apache.axis2.transaction
Class TransactionConfiguration

java.lang.Object
  extended by org.apache.axis2.transaction.TransactionConfiguration

public class TransactionConfiguration
extends Object


Field Summary
static int DEFAULT_TX_TIME_OUT
           
static String TX_MANAGER_JNDI_NAME
           
 
Constructor Summary
TransactionConfiguration()
           
TransactionConfiguration(ParameterInclude transactionParameters)
           
 
Method Summary
 TransactionManager getTransactionManager()
           
 int getTransactionTimeout()
           
 UserTransaction getUserTransaction()
           
 void setTransactionTimeout(int transactionTimeout)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

DEFAULT_TX_TIME_OUT

public static final int DEFAULT_TX_TIME_OUT
See Also:
Constant Field Values

TX_MANAGER_JNDI_NAME

public static final String TX_MANAGER_JNDI_NAME
See Also:
Constant Field Values
Constructor Detail

TransactionConfiguration

public TransactionConfiguration()

TransactionConfiguration

public TransactionConfiguration(ParameterInclude transactionParameters)
                         throws DeploymentException
Throws:
DeploymentException
Method Detail

getTransactionTimeout

public int getTransactionTimeout()

setTransactionTimeout

public void setTransactionTimeout(int transactionTimeout)

getTransactionManager

public TransactionManager getTransactionManager()
                                         throws AxisFault
Throws:
AxisFault

getUserTransaction

public UserTransaction getUserTransaction()
                                   throws AxisFault
Throws:
AxisFault


Copyright © 2004-2012 The Apache Software Foundation. All Rights Reserved.